In North Carolina, this type of agreement allows you to avoid a conviction on your record if you meet the terms of the agreement. 4 Points Reckless driving (Misdemeanor) Hit and run, property damage only (Misdemeanor) (If personal injury = Felony) Following too closely Driving on wrong side of road Illegal passing 3 Points Running through a stop sign Speeding in excess of 55 miles per hour Failing to yield right-of-way Running through red light No driver's license or license expired more than one year Failure to stop for siren Driving through safety zone No liability insurance Failure to report accident where such report is required Speeding in a school zone in excess of the posted school zone speed limit 2 Points All other moving violations Failure to properly restrain a child in a restraint or seat belt 1 Point Littering involving use of motor vehicle 0 Points Seat Beat Violation Improper Equipment/plates/registration/muffler/inspection sticker display. Driving past the speed limit of 0 to 5 miles per hour(mph) will cost you $10 plus the administrative and Court fee, Driving past the speed limit of 6 to 10 miles per hour(mph) will cost you $15 plus the administrative and Court fee, Driving past the speed limit of 11-15 miles per hour(mph) will cost you$30 plus administrative and court fee, Driving past the speed limit of 16 miles per hour (mph) or higher will cost you $50 plus other costs. In 1985, the North Carolina General Assembly wrote into law that if a motorist receives a citation for speeding and has not had a speeding violation in the past three years, that the citation could be reduced to 9 mph or less over the speed limit and it would not affect the driver's insurance, which is what kicks your butt for three years.
